The Baltimore Collegetown Network brings 13 colleges and universities together to attract, engage, and retain students and raise the profile of Baltimore as a great college town. The Baltimore Collegetown Network connects colleges and energetically works to attract, engage, and retain students, our region’s next citizens, and leaders. With 13 colleges and 120,000 students, Baltimore is a great college town!

Welcome back to campus - the Collegetown Shuttle is back, too! Shuttle service will begin for the fall on August 24 and run through December 12. Hope to see you on board soon! 🚌⁠

The Collegetown Shuttle is a FREE service for students, staff, and faculty at Johns Hopkins University, Notre Dame of Maryland University, and Towson University.

Calling creatives, designers, engineers, students, and more! The Baltimore Development Corporation (BDC), in partnership with the City of Baltimore, invites artists, architects, designers, planners, engineers, students, community organizations, and multidisciplinary teams to participate in the Design Baltimore: Gateways Competition.

This is a citywide design challenge seeking bold, innovative, and implementable ideas that transform Baltimore's primary vehicular gateways into iconic arrival experiences that celebrate the city's identity, history, culture, and future.

That's a wrap on the SEE Program for 2026! ✨️

Collegetown held the closing celebrations for the 2026 Sophomore Externship Experience program on Tuesday at the Johns Hopkins Carey Business School with program partners from CollegeBound Foundation, BGE, Under Armour, and Whiting-Turner in attendance. Each student presented their capstone project that showcased their talents, career interests, and hard work throughout the summer.

For the second week of the SEE Program, our students visited with Whiting-Turner and learned the ins-and-outs of the construction industry from a major Baltimore-based employer. Externs were able to get a first-hand look at construction management and a multitude of backgrounds, career paths, and majors that have helped strengthen the region, and an insight into service learning opportunities in the city!
